Output 5526fd5f6a11dcfc19e43b92ce5b4d07a1d2fec2b5d2fc409155e0b3b0a82e99:1

value
108831126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d691d74ba389dfced82197ad14b12e8ff4436042 OP_EQUAL
address
3MFZEogSikehLAQbkchvYuLDQAxSmCeami
transaction
5526fd5f6a11dcfc19e43b92ce5b4d07a1d2fec2b5d2fc409155e0b3b0a82e99
confirmations
387449
spent
true